Past Project Success
• Our team has supported Volusia County for many years and was available to assist prior Hurricane Matthew’s landfall, and in the immediate aftermath
• Mobilized a team within hours and began the process of supporting debris removal monitoring and operations
Volusia County, Florida – Hurricane Matthew
• Grant management specialists assisted with FEMA project worksheets for reimbursement claims estimated at $30 Million
• PW’s covered all categories of work, including improved projects, alternate projects, and 406 hazard mitigation
• Also providing Technical Assistance to the County in regards to other post-disaster federal grants including USDA, HUD, and FHWA-ER.

• Tetra Tech assisted the County immediately after the flood to perform a comprehensive needs assessment of the County followed by a strategic analysis of available grant funds
• $26.5 million in HUD CDBG-DR grant funds was subsequently awarded to the County
• Tetra Tech assisted the County with preparation of an Action Plan that was approved by HUD in five days
• Our team provided comprehensive grant implementation services, including outreach, case management, and management of permanent home repairs, and economic development projects▪ Repair of over 270 roads and bridges
▪ Well testing & disinfection program
▪ Debris removal
▪ Long-Term recovery workshops
▪ CDBG-DR management & oversight; HMGP grant applications
Richland County, South Carolina – 1,000 Year Flood

• The Tetra Tech team has been supporting multiple emergency management efforts for the Metropolitan Atlanta Rapid Transit Authority’s (MARTA) since 2010
• MARTA initially appointed our team to develop a threat and vulnerability assessment (TVA) and continuity of operations (COOP) plan
• Over the last 8 years, our team of emergency management personnel have conducted the following projects for MARTA:
Metro Atlanta Regional Transit Authority (MARTA)
▪ Continuity of Operations Planning
▪ Security and Emergency Preparedness Planning
▪ Emergency Operations Planning
▪ FTA, TSA, and State Regulatory Compliance
▪ SOP Development
▪ Training and Exercise Program
▪ HSEEP-Compliant Exercise Program Development, Facilitation and evaluation
▪ After Action Report/Improvement Plan Development
▪ Emergency Operations Training
▪ Incident Command System (ICS) Training
